Sanjay Nirupam alleges ‘Housing Jihad’ in Mumbai, AIMIM calls It baseless


Daijiworld Media Network - Mumbai

Mumbai, Feb 21: Shiv Sena leader Sanjay Nirupam has stirred controversy by alleging that Muslim builders are rejecting Hindu applicants in Slum Rehabilitation Authority (SRA) projects in Mumbai, calling it ‘Housing Jihad.’

Nirupam has written to Maharashtra housing minister and deputy CM Eknath Shinde, urging an investigation into the matter. He claimed that such activities are rampant in western suburbs, as well as areas like Govandi, Mankhurd, Kurla, Saki Naka, and Bandra.

As per Nirupam, “Muslim builders are ensuring only Muslims get homes in SRA projects, making Hindus a minority in several areas.” He further alleged that around 10% of Mumbai’s 600 ongoing SRA projects are handled by Muslim builders, all of whom are involved in this alleged practice. He also claimed that Bangladeshi nationals are being given permanent housing through an illegal campaign.

However, AIMIM national spokesperson Waris Pathan dismissed Nirupam’s claims as “complete nonsense.” He said, “First, they alleged love jihad, then land jihad, and now housing jihad. Do they even understand the meaning of jihad?”

This is not the first time Nirupam has sparked controversy. Last month, he questioned actor Saif Ali Khan’s rapid recovery after surgery, demanding clarity from Lilavati Hospital on his treatment.
